Specific function: Methyltransferase Required For The Conversion Of Dimethylmenaquinone (Dmkh2) To Menaquinone (Mkh2) And The Conversion Of 2-Polyprenyl-6-Methoxy-1,4-Benzoquinol (Ddmqh2) To 2-Polyprenyl-3-Methyl-6-Methoxy-1,4-Benzoquinol (Dmqh2). [C]
